Transaction 28153f23117f4dc7ff13729df5118412124264964a3870f421ad730415096947

1 Input
2 Outputs
  • 28153f23117f4dc7ff13729df5118412124264964a3870f421ad730415096947:0
  • value  664149
    address  3Hy8WZs9fShJ5PyhLtzVS2FgdMnBY8gmDL
  • 28153f23117f4dc7ff13729df5118412124264964a3870f421ad730415096947:1
  • value  1683745
    address  1JLU7cL8whndAjnep8sYii5LqCw8BQvMBR